Chromone: A valid scaffold in medicinal chemistry

Gaspar, Alexandra; Matos, Maria João; Garrido, Jorge; Uriarte, Eugénio; Borges, Fernanda

Chromones are a group of naturally occurring compounds that are ubiquitous in nature, especially in plants. The word chromone is derived from the Greek word chroma, meaning “color”, which point out that many chromone derivatives can exhibit a diversity of colors.
